Summary
The ICT Support Officer requires broad technical knowledge and systems management experience. He/she also must work well with people and coordinate efforts with Cuso International’s ICT Team based at headquarters and any regional ICT support staff.
Key responsibilities
Business management
- Help establish, communicate, and maintain organization-wide ICT policies
- Maintain accurate asset management records in collaboration with the Finance and Administration team
- In collaboration with the Country Program Office (CPO) Finance Officer and HQ-based ICT Team, research and negotiate contracts for the purchase and/or lease of new office equipment
- Help forecast ICT costs and expenses for budgeting purposes
- Dispose of unneeded ICT equipment and media in a secure and environmentally responsible manner
Security
- Ensure networks, information systems and data are accessible only by authorized staff
- Implement and maintain tools to protect the organization’s networks, information systems and data against computer viruses, spam, network intrusion, and related threats
Availability
- Maintain an appropriate CPO data backup regime
- Verify backups are functional and safely stored
- Develop and implement a disaster recovery plan for data stored in the CPO
Configuration and change management
- Install, configure and manage:
o Desktop hardware (workstations, laptops), system software (Windows operating system,
Symantec anti-virus, Skype, printer drivers etc…) and application software for staff, volunteers and Youth Resource Centres (YRC).
(Microsoft Office, Adobe Acrobat Reader, clients for main line-of-business applications)
o Server hardware and software (Microsoft Windows Server, Active Directory, Symantec anti-virus server, shared folder configuration and security)
o Network hardware (switches, firewall appliance, Ethernet cabling, wireless access points)
o Printers, scanners and other peripherals
- Plan system changes thoroughly (schedule, communicate to staff, backup, implement, test, rollback if necessary, backup, communicate to staff)
Operations and performance management
- Develop and implement routine software and hardware maintenance procedures
- Monitoring network and application performance to support capacity planning
- Train staff when required in new ICT tools
Problem management
- Prioritize and manage ICT issues as the first level of support in the CPO
- Offer ICT support to other CPOs in the region, which may require travel occasionally
- When necessary, escalate issues to the second level of support (either the regional ICT Support person or the ICT Team at HQ)
Special projects
As Cuso International implements and updates information systems and technologies, the ICT Support Officer at the CPO is expected to assist and represent the CPO’s particular circumstances, opportunities and constraints.
